    Ecommerce boosts sales for Domino's Pizza

The pizza giant's web sales are looking pretty healthy.

By Maggie Holland, 8 Jan 2008 at 16:52

Domino's Pizza today published its Christmas trading update, showing that its online arm has made a massive contribution to the company's growing popularity and profits.

Total ecommerce sales for the pizza giant in the UK and Ireland were up 102 per cent for the six weeks ending 30 December 2007, while total web income for the whole year were £32.2 million - up 60.5 per cent on 2006's figure of £20.1 million.

Last year, Domino's Pizza passed an important milestone when it reported online sales of £1 million in a single week during the month of November.

"Last year, web sales reached £23 million in total and we responded to customer demand by significantly increasing our online presence - we're delighted to see that paying off with £1 million worth of sales in a week for the very first time," Robin Auld, the company's marketing director, said at the time.

Customer demand for online ordering contributed to an all-round good set of results for Domino's Pizza, with overall total like-for-like sales growth of 17.6 per cent for the six weeks ending 30 December 2007, while full year sales shot up by 14.7 per cent.

"Last year was a tremendous year for Domino's Pizza in the UK and Ireland. Our strong sales performance was fuelled by the strong marketing of new products, continual improvement in customer service times which we know directly impact on propensity to re-order and the superior quality of our product," said Chris Moore, chief executive of Domino's Pizza UK and Ireland.
